The International Court of Justice and the Palestine-Israel Crisis: Past, Present, and Future

Higgins Lounge, Dana Commons

The International Court of Justice, the UN’s highest court, took up two cases regarding the Palestine-Israel crisis at the start of the year. Two legal experts will explain the genesis of the cases, the strengths and weaknesses of both, as well as their broader local, regional, and global implications.

Video Exhibition: ‘Applied Motion Studies: Artists and Scientists Consider Movement’

Higgins Lounge, 2nd Floor, Dana Commons Clark University

Applied Motion Studies: Artists and Scientists Consider Movement features a diverse array of short films that blend artists’ creative visions with scientists’ analytical perspectives. The exhibition is open Tuesday, Wednesday, and Thursday, from 9:30 to 3:30 p.m. through May 20.

Liberating Language Skills: Critical Pedagogy for Refugee Empowerment in Employment

online

Eliana Stanislawski will discuss strategies for increasing educational access for adult refugee learners, developing innovative approaches to virtual learning for adults at all language levels, and challenging the deficit mindset that is pervasive in Adult ESOL and refugee resettlement work.
